1. Point of Impact

April 22, 1972 · 48 min

Violence flares up when a student protest meets a counter-demonstration. A young protestor is killed by a blow to the head. The nearest to the body is a mounted Officer Tyrell. DCS John Kingdom now faces a difficult case, where strong evidence accumulates against a brother policeman.

2. The Comeback

April 29, 1972 · 60 min

A retired bank manager is murdered in a seemingly motiveless killing. Then, a second murder is committed, and Kingdom, together with his journalist brother-in-law Harry Carson, discovers a possible motive which might also pose a threat to Kingdom's life.

3. Memory of a Gauntlet

May 6, 1972 · 60 min

A postman is found murdered by his wife, his body surrounded by Nazi emblems and insignia; it looks like a murder committed by a fanatical ex-Nazi hunter. Kingdom persuades a reporter to splash the story. It has the required effect, and stirs up an ugly situation.

4. The Palais Romeo

May 13, 1972 · 60 min

When a woman is found dead on a canal towpath, Kingdom finds himself investigating the third of a series of murders. All the victims are attractive middle-aged women and, despite Inspectors Ward's scepticism, Kingdom becomes obsessed with his theory the murderer is a young man. As the case continues, Ward becomes more and more convinced that Kingdom is on the wrong track.

5. Hard Contract

May 20, 1972 · 60 min

As he investigates two murders, Kingdom discovers that both victims had recently returned from abroad, and both were shot by the same gun. When a third shooting takes place, his research reveals they are linked.

A girl is found murdered on a rubbish dump, and Kingdom's investigation leads him into the world of drop-outs. As he builds a picture of the dead girl and searches for a motive, one question haunts: why was her body placed in that particular location?

12. Reunion

July 8, 1972 · 60 min

On the night that Steve Thomas escapes from prison, a solicitor is found murdered in his office – and £11 is missing from the cash box. Kingdom and Ward investigate, but why should anyone commit murder for such a small sum?

13. And When You're Wrong

July 15, 1972 · 60 min

Ward hopes to catch the brain behind a series of bank robberies through his contract with shady ex-insurance agent Charles Prentice. But when Ward arrives at Prentice's flat to finalise arrangements, he finds Kingdom, who is there to investigate a murder – and the Inspector's activities.
